Equipment preparation and compatibility testing
Before you begin changing settings, you must ensure that your hardware is physically and software-ready to operate in advanced mode. Not all modifications Keenetic Support the repeater function out of the box, although most modern KeeneticOS firmware versions offer this capability. It's important to check the software version, as older versions may lack the required functionality or be unstable.
You will need a main router that already distributes the Internet, and Zyxel Keenetic 4G, which will act as an amplifier. The distance between them during the setup process should be minimal—it's best to perform all configuration steps in the same room. This will prevent packet loss and connection interruptions while making configuration changes.
- 📡 Make sure your main router is distributing Wi-Fi and you know its password.
- 🔌 Connect your computer or laptop to Keenetic 4G via cable or standard Wi-Fi network.
- 💻 Check that your PC's network card is configured to obtain an IP address automatically (DHCP).
It's worth noting that the repeater mode requires operation within a single subnet, which can cause IP address conflicts if the default settings are not changed. DHCP server on the secondary device should be disabled to avoid creating chaos in the network. It is also recommended to reset it beforehand. Keenetic to factory settings if it was previously used to distribute 3G/4G Internet, to avoid connection profile conflicts.
⚠️ Attention: If your Zyxel Keenetic 4G If the device is rented from a mobile operator (MTS, Beeline, Tele2), it may have a firmware blocker or a modified version of the firmware. In this case, the standard procedure may not work, and you will need to find specific unlocking instructions or replace the firmware.
Login to the web interface and update the firmware
The first step is to access the router's control panel. By default, devices Zyxel have an IP address 192.168.1.1 or domain name my.keenetic.netOpen any browser and enter this address in the address bar. If you are connected correctly, a login window will appear. The default login and password are usually found on a sticker on the bottom of the device, most often admin And admin or 1234.
After successful authorization, the system may offer to update the software. KeeneticOS This is a live system that regularly receives security updates and new features. Ignoring this step is not recommended, as older versions may contain bugs in the wireless module or WDS function.
To update, go to the menu System → Software UpdateIf the automatic search doesn't find any new versions, you can check for updates manually through the "Available Updates" tab. The process takes a few minutes and requires a stable internet connection (either through your main router or a temporary cable connection from your ISP).
After rebooting, ensure you can log in to the interface again. The device is now ready for major configuration changes. It's important to remember the new administrator password if you decide to change it, as without it, you will lose access to management.
Setting the operating mode: switching to an access point
The key to turning a router into a repeater is changing its operating mode. In terminology Zyxel This is often referred to as "Access Point" or "Repeater" mode. In newer versions of the KeeneticOS interface, this functionality may be located in a separate quick setup wizard or under the "Operating Mode" section.
Find the item in the menu Opening hours (usually in the top or side menu). Here you will be offered several options: "Router," "Access Point," "Repeater." For our purposes, the "Repeater" mode is optimal. Access point With a Wi-Fi connection if a wired connection between the routers is not possible. If you plan to connect them with a cable, select access point mode with an Ethernet connection.
When selecting wireless mode, the system will ask you to select the network of the main router. Keenetic The router will scan the air and display a list of available networks. Select your primary network from the list and enter the password. The router will then attempt to connect to it as a client.
- 🔍 Select the SSID of the main network from the list of available ones.
- 🔑 Enter the password for your main Wi-Fi network.
- 📶 Select the frequency range (2.4 GHz or 5 GHz) to connect to the main router.
If you are using a wired connection, simply connect the cable from the LAN port of the main router to the WAN port (or any LAN, depending on the model) Keenetic 4GThe system will automatically detect the presence of a cable and prompt you to switch to the appropriate mode. This will result in higher and more stable speeds, as the channel won't be overloaded with data transfer between routers.
⚠️ Attention: When switching operating modes, the device's IP address may change. If the main router distributes addresses in the 192.168.0.x range, and Keenetic has a static IP address of 192.168.1.1, you may lose access to its interface. In this case, use the utility Keenetic Finder or reset the device using the Reset button.
Wireless Network Configuration and SSID Cloning
One of the most important tasks when setting up a repeater is the correct network name (SSID) and password. To create a seamless roaming effect (although full roaming requires 802.11r/k/v support), it is recommended to use same network name and a password on both devices. This will allow your devices to automatically switch to a stronger signal.
Go to your wireless network settings Home Network → Wi-Fi NetworkHere you can set the network name. If you want devices to choose the best access point themselves, copy the SSID and password from the main router. However, keep in mind that older devices may latch onto a weak signal and not switch to a stronger one until the connection is completely lost.
Another option is to create a network with a different name, for example, by adding the suffix "_ext" or "_repeater." This gives you complete control over which access point your smartphone or laptop connects to. This approach is often more stable in mixed networks with different equipment.
Don't forget to set up security. Use encryption standards. WPA2-PSK or WPA3, if all your devices support it. Setting a weak password or using WEP encryption will make your extended network vulnerable to hacking, as the repeater broadcasts the signal over long distances, potentially beyond your home.
Channel optimization and interference elimination
The performance of a repeater directly depends on the noise level in the air. In apartment buildings, the 2.4 GHz band is often oversaturated with signals from neighboring networks. Zyxel Keenetic has built-in analysis tools that will help you choose the best channel.
In the Wi-Fi settings section, find the "Wi-Fi Analyzer" or "Network Scanner" tool. Run a scan and look at the channel utilization chart. Your goal is to find the channel that is least used by your neighbors. For the 2.4 GHz band, non-overlapping channels are 1, 6, and 11.
| Parameter | Recommendation for 2.4 GHz | Recommendation for 5 GHz | Impact on speed |
|---|---|---|---|
| Channel width | 20 MHz (for stability) | 40/80 MHz | Increasing width increases speed but decreases range |
| Channel | 1, 6 or 11 | Any free (36-64) | The right choice reduces the number of errors |
| Signal strength | 100% (maximum) | 100% | Reducing power can improve roaming |
It's also worth paying attention to the channel width. Although the standard allows for 40 MHz in the 2.4 GHz band, in densely populated areas this often leads to a drop in speed due to overlap with neighboring networks. Forced channel width 20 MHz may paradoxically increase the actual data transfer rate by reducing the number of retransmissions.

Diagnostics and troubleshooting
Even with proper setup, there may be situations where the internet through the repeater is slow or intermittently drops out. First, check the signal strength between the main router and Keenetic 4GIf the repeater is located too far from the signal source, it will transmit a weak and noisy signal, resulting in low speed.
A common problem is a network loop or IP address conflict if both devices have a DHCP server active. Make sure that Keenetic In repeater mode, the DHCP server is disabled or operates in "Relay" mode, although in modern KeeneticOS firmware this happens automatically when the correct operating mode is selected.
If the speed through the repeater is less than 50% of the speed on the main router, this may be due to a feature of the wireless bridge. Using a single radio module for both receiving and transmitting data inevitably cuts the speed in half. Using dual-band models or a wired backhaul (connection between routers) solves this problem.
Why does Wi-Fi speed drop when using a repeater?
A wireless repeater operates in half-duplex mode. It cannot simultaneously receive and transmit data on the same frequency. Therefore, the bandwidth is divided between clients and the communication channel with the main router. This is a physical limitation of the technology, which can be circumvented by using a separate radio channel (5 GHz) for communication between routers, while maintaining 2.4 GHz for clients.
Logging can help in complex cases. In the interface Keenetic There's a "Diagnostics" or "System Log" section. Enable event logging and reproduce the problem. The logs will tell you whether the connection is being lost at the wireless link level or whether the issue lies in the DHCP/DNS settings.

Frequently Asked Questions (FAQ)
Can Zyxel Keenetic 4G be used as a repeater for a router of another brand (TP-Link, Asus)?
Yes, this is possible. WDS technology, or client-access point mode, is standard. The main requirement is that both devices support the same security standards (WPA2) and are in compatible frequency bands. Problems may only arise when using proprietary mesh networking technologies from specific vendors.
How many devices can be connected to Keenetic 4G in repeater mode?
The device theoretically supports up to 32 clients on a wireless network, but the actual number depends on processor load and user activity. For comfortable operation, it is recommended to not exceed 10-15 active devices, especially if encryption and traffic filtering are used.
Does internet speed drop when connecting through a repeater?
With a wireless connection, speed loss is inevitable and can range from 20% to 50% depending on the signal quality between the routers. When using a cable (access point mode with an Ethernet cable), speed loss is virtually nonexistent.
Do I need to set up a static IP for the repeater?
It is advisable to reserve an IP address for Keenetic In the main router settings, or assign a static IP address to the LAN itself so that the device's address doesn't change after a reboot. This will simplify access to its management interface in the future.
